The electric forklift battery is the most vulnerable part of the electric forklift. The actual scrapping time of most forklift battery is much earlier than the design life of the electric forklift battery. The reason is the same, not using the forklift and maintaining the forklift battery according to the specifications!
The daily maintenance and maintenance of the electric forklift battery should be highly concerned by every operator and manager. Adding water to the forklift battery is a very simple matter, but it is also very knowledgeable. If it is not possible, it will cause more damage to the electric forklift battery.
Let's take a look at the two misunderstandings about the replenishment of the forklift battery:
Misunderstanding 1: Can the pure drinking water be used for electric forklift battery?

Can not be applied, because the daily consumption of pure water, the impurity content of the people is much higher than the forklift battery water requirements, pure water contains a variety of trace elements, will have a bad impact on the electric forklift battery.
The water of the forklift battery should meet the requirements of JB/T10053-1999 standard, which can not be achieved. Therefore, we must remember that when the electric forklift battery is in the absence of electrolyte, it should be supplemented with distilled water or special rehydration, and should not be replaced with pure drinking water.
Myth 2: Can the forklift battery be added with distilled water at any time?
In the routine maintenance of the electric forklift battery, when the electrolyte of the forklift battery is insufficient, it is generally necessary to add distilled water to the electric forklift battery. However, sometimes the electrolyte of the forklift battery is reduced due to cracks in the battery casing of the forklift or the leakage of the liquid-filled cover buckle causes the electrolyte to leak. However, some drivers often do not pay attention to distinguish between the liquid level of the electric forklift battery due to damage or other causes of electrolyte leakage, or normal loss, as long as the electrolyte level is reduced, adding distilled water, resulting in a significant decrease in electrolyte density. So that the forklift battery does not work properly.
Some drivers often add distilled water to the electric forklift battery after the end of the forklift. As a result, the added distilled water cannot be fully mixed with the original electrolyte of the forklift battery, thus easily causing the electric forklift battery to self-discharge or damage the forklift battery plate in the severe cold area. It also causes local freezing of the electric forklift battery, which affects the service life of the forklift battery.
Conversely, if distilled water is added to the electric forklift battery before using the forklift, the distilled water can be fully mixed with the original electrolyte in the forklift battery, and the performance of the electric forklift battery will not be affected. Therefore, distilled water should be added before using the forklift, and it is not advisable to add distilled water after using the forklift.
Generally, the electrolyte in the forklift battery will evaporate during charging and use, so the concentration will increase, generally adding water, and adding 1.26% of the electrolyte when the specific gravity is low. The proportion of the electric forklift battery after charging is 1.28.
Pay attention to the above, the forklift battery will be used for a longer time, and the forklift battery life can be maintained.
